What initially made me like mha is how they showed how hero society failed people, aptly through the league of villains. Spinner had a mutant quirk that caused him to be the target of discrimination in more backwater settings. This was expanded upon with tentacole guy where he said in rural areas people will literally try to do ethnic cleansing.
Toga had a quirk that was deemed 'not normal' and underwent 'quirk counselling' which only suppressed her quirk and didn't solve anything. And yet at the end, a bunch of the UA heroes, uraraka, momo, tsuyu and iida are now doing a 'quirk counselling' expansion project??? The fuck is the 'quirk counselling' they're advocating for??
Twice was also a prime example of how hero society failed him. Heroes failed to save his parents, making him an orphan. Nobody helped him when he lost his job. He turned to a life of crime to survive not only with being homeless and living a life of poverty, but being lonely too. He literally had a mental illness resulting from the trauma of his quirk and barely got treatment for it.
